- Tupac Shakur. 13,845 votes. Beyond a shadow of a doubt, the late Tupac Shakur had an unparalleled impact on hip hop and the music industry as a whole. From the raw emotion in his voice to the powerful messages in tracks like "Brenda's Got a Baby" and "Keep Ya Head Up," Shakur created a movement that transcended generations.
- N.W.A. 7,786 votes. When discussing groundbreaking hip hop groups, it's impossible not to mention N.W.A. Composed of Dr. Dre, Ice Cube, Eazy-E, MC Ren, and DJ Yella, the group's unapologetic and socially aware lyrics illustrated the harsh reality of life on the streets of Compton, California.
- Eazy-E. 5,768 votes. As one of the founding members of N.W.A, Eazy-E played a monumental role in the development of West Coast rap. His distinctive high-pitched, raspy voice and gritty storytelling made him stand out from the pack.
- Snoop Dogg. 10,124 votes. With his laid-back demeanor and smooth flow, Snoop Dogg has solidified his status as a West Coast rap legend. Bursting onto the scene with his debut album Doggystyle, Snoop quickly became a household name due in part to his affiliation with Dr. Dre and his unique style.
